The article explains that SPTAR, a hospital specializing in orthopedic surgery and sports medicine, is providing comprehensive medical support to the Qatar delegation at the Nagoya 2026 Asian Games, scheduled to take place in Japan from September 19 to October 4. The medical team consists of 28 specialized experts, including sports medicine physicians, physical therapists, and sports massage therapists, offering injury assessment, treatment, recovery and performance support, emergency care, and ongoing health monitoring. The hospital also provides a medical clinic at the delegation’s headquarters and works to support the 243 athletes out of a total of 427 participants, aiming to maintain their mental and physical readiness throughout the competition. This initiative comes as part of Qatar’s broader efforts to enhance sports support and prepare for hosting the 2030 Asian Games, with a focus on delivering high-quality medical care and keeping pace with scientific advancements.
